Water under a house’s foundation can cause significant damage by putting pressure on the foundation, resulting in cracks, leaks, and structural issues. There are several signs to look for to determine if a water problem has caused damage to the foundation. Too much water can cause the soil to expand, which puts pressure on the foundation and damages the concrete. Discover how you can reduce. Sadly, there are a range of things that can lead to foundations damaged by water such as plumbing leaks, extreme weather, and basement leaks. Standing water caused by basement leaks;
